Borough High Weight —Patutahi, Marble King, Arch Eagle. Puriri Hack—Foot Rule. Miss Albyn, Mauriaena. Hauraki Handicap—King Willonyx, Sir Mond. Valsier. A MEETING POSTPONED WHANGAREI, 6th January. On account of the general depression, the Waipapakauri Racing Club has decided to postpone its Annual Meeting, listed for 24th January. It may apply to the Dates Committee later in the season if circumstances warrant it doing so.
